CREAMED SPINACH | SPINACH RECIPES | JAMIE OLIVER RECIPES
Frozen spinach is not only cheap and convenient, it seems to work much better than fresh in this dish. A savoury crumble topping takes it to the next level.
Total Time 1 hours 20 minutes
Yield 10 as a side
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- 1. Preheat the oven to 180°C/350°F/gas 4. 2. Peel and finely chop the onions and garlic, then place in a large frying pan on a low heat with 2 tablespoons of oil and the oregano. 3. Finely grate in half the nutmeg and fry gently for 10 minutes, or until soft but not coloured, stirring regularly. 4. Add the spinach, turn the heat up to medium and cook down for 15 to 20 minutes, or until any liquid has evaporated. 5. Meanwhile, roughly chop the cold butter, grate the cheese and place in a food processor with the flour, oats and a pinch of sea salt and black pepper. Pulse into a nice crumble texture (or rub together by hand), then remove to a plate. 6. Put the cooked spinach mixture into the processor (there’s no need to clean it), then add the crème fraîche and blitz for 1 minute. 7. Taste and season to perfection, then tip evenly into a baking dish (20cm x 30cm). Sprinkle over the crumble and bake for around 45 minutes, or until golden and bubbling.

CREAMED SPINACH RECIPE - BBC GOOD FOOD
What can be better than a side of creamy, nutmeg-infused spinach? Perfect to accompany any roast and especially good at Christmas
Provided by Good Food team
Categories Dinner, Side dish
Total Time 25 minutes
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Heat 25g butter in a saucepan, then add 1 finely chopped small onion and cook for 5 mins until softened.
- Stir in 2 tbsp plain flour and cook for 2 mins, then slowly start to whisk in 200ml full-fat milk. When it has all been incorporated, gently cook for 5 mins until the sauce has thickened.
- Meanwhile, place two 200g bags spinach in a large colander. Pour over a kettle full of boiling water until the leaves have wilted (you may have to do this twice).
- Place the spinach in a clean dishcloth, squeeze out any excess liquid, then roughly chop.
- Stir into the sauce with 100ml single cream, gently heat, then finely grate over some fresh nutmeg and season well.
